Impact de l'eau sur la s\u00e9curit\u00e9 des piles au lithium<\/strong><\/p><p>L'eau est l'une des substances nocives pr\u00e9sentes dans les piles au lithium. Un exc\u00e8s d'eau peut entra\u00eener des probl\u00e8mes de s\u00e9curit\u00e9 tels que des courts-circuits, des dilatations et des ruptures \u00e0 l'int\u00e9rieur des piles au lithium. L'eau provenant des mati\u00e8res premi\u00e8res et du processus de production est la principale voie d'entr\u00e9e de l'eau \u00e0 l'int\u00e9rieur des piles au lithium. Par cons\u00e9quent, dans le processus de production des piles au lithium, la teneur en eau doit \u00eatre strictement contr\u00f4l\u00e9e pour garantir la s\u00e9curit\u00e9 des piles au lithium.<\/p><p><strong>2. L'effet de l'eau sur les performances des piles au lithium<\/strong><\/p><p>L'eau n'affecte pas seulement la s\u00e9curit\u00e9 de la pile au lithium, mais aussi ses performances. Une bonne quantit\u00e9 d'eau peut favoriser la r\u00e9action \u00e9lectrochimique de la pile au lithium, am\u00e9liorer la capacit\u00e9 et les performances de la pile. <span style=\"text-decoration: underline;color: #333399\"><a style=\"color: #333399;text-decoration: underline\" href=\"https:\/\/batteryswapstation.com\/fr\/charging-and-discharging-of-lithium-ion-battery\/\" target=\"_blank\" rel=\"noopener\">charge et d\u00e9charge de la batterie au lithium-ion<\/a><\/span>.<\/p><p>Cependant, un exc\u00e8s d'eau entra\u00eene une baisse des performances de la batterie et r\u00e9duit sa dur\u00e9e de vie. Par cons\u00e9quent, dans le processus de production des piles au lithium, la teneur en eau doit \u00eatre strictement contr\u00f4l\u00e9e pour obtenir les meilleures performances de la pile.<\/p><p><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ter size-full wp-image-31370\" src=\"https:\/\/batteryswapstation.com\/wp-content\/uploads\/2024\/01\/Impact-of-water-on-lithium-battery-process.webp\" alt=\"Impact de l&#039;eau sur le processus des batteries au lithium\" width=\"1200\" height=\"600\" \/><\/p><h2 id=\"hazards-of-water-on-lithium-batteries\">Dangers de l'eau pour les piles au lithium<\/h2><h3 id=\"battery-swelling-and-leakage\">Gonflement et fuite de la batterie<\/h3><p>Si la teneur en eau de la batterie lithium-ion est trop \u00e9lev\u00e9e, elle r\u00e9agit avec le sel de lithium de l'\u00e9lectrolyte pour former du HF :<\/p><p><em><strong>H2O + LiPF6 \u2192 POF3 + LiF + 2HF<\/strong><\/em><\/p><p>L'acide fluorhydrique (HF) est un acide tr\u00e8s corrosif qui d\u00e9truit les performances des piles :<\/p><p>Le HF corrode les pi\u00e8ces m\u00e9talliques \u00e0 l'int\u00e9rieur de la batterie, le bo\u00eetier de la batterie et le joint d'\u00e9tanch\u00e9it\u00e9, ce qui finit par provoquer la rupture de la batterie et des fuites.<\/p><p>Le HF d\u00e9truit l'interface solide-\u00e9lectrolyte \u00e0 l'int\u00e9rieur de la batterie et r\u00e9agit avec les principaux composants de la membrane SEI :<\/p><p><em><strong>ROCO2Li + HF \u2192 ROCO2H + LiF<\/strong><\/em><br \/><em><strong>Li2CO3 + 2HF \u2192 H2CO3 + 2LiF<\/strong><\/em><\/p><p>Enfin, la pr\u00e9cipitation de LiF est g\u00e9n\u00e9r\u00e9e \u00e0 l'int\u00e9rieur de la batterie, provoquant des r\u00e9actions chimiques irr\u00e9versibles des ions de lithium dans la batterie. <span style=\"text-decoration: underline;color: #333399\"><a style=\"color: #333399;text-decoration: underline\" href=\"https:\/\/batteryswapstation.com\/fr\/lithium-ion-battery-anode-materials\/\" target=\"_blank\" rel=\"noopener\">anode de batterie lithium-ion<\/a><\/span>L'\u00e9nergie de la batterie est donc r\u00e9duite, car elle consomme des ions lithium actifs.<\/p><p>Lorsqu'il y a suffisamment d'humidit\u00e9, davantage de gaz est produit, et la pression \u00e0 l'int\u00e9rieur de la batterie augmente, ce qui entra\u00eene une d\u00e9formation de la batterie sous l'effet de la contrainte, et il y a un risque de gonflement de la batterie et de fuite.<\/p><p>Sur le march\u00e9, lors de l'utilisation de t\u00e9l\u00e9phones portables ou de produits \u00e9lectroniques num\u00e9riques, la batterie se gonfle, le couvercle s'ouvre, la plupart de ces situations sont dues \u00e0 la forte teneur en eau interne des batteries au lithium, la production de gaz \u00e9tant caus\u00e9e par le gonflement.<\/p><p><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ter size-full wp-image-31371\" src=\"https:\/\/batteryswapstation.com\/wp-content\/uploads\/2024\/01\/Hazards-of-water-on-lithium-batteries.webp\" alt=\"Dangers de l&#039;eau sur les piles au lithium\" width=\"1200\" height=\"600\" \/><\/p><h3 id=\"the-internal-resistance-of-the-battery-becomes-bigger\">La r\u00e9sistance interne de la batterie augmente<\/h3><p>La r\u00e9sistance interne de la batterie est l'un des param\u00e8tres de performance les plus importants de la batterie, c'est le principal symbole pour mesurer la difficult\u00e9 de transmission des ions et des \u00e9lectrons \u00e0 l'int\u00e9rieur de la batterie, ce qui affecte directement la dur\u00e9e du cycle et l'\u00e9tat de fonctionnement de la batterie ; plus la r\u00e9sistance interne est faible, plus la tension occup\u00e9e lorsque la batterie est d\u00e9charg\u00e9e est faible, et plus elle produit d'\u00e9nergie.<\/p><p>Lorsque la teneur en eau augmente, des pr\u00e9cipitations de POF3 et de LiF sont g\u00e9n\u00e9r\u00e9es \u00e0 la surface de l'interface solide-\u00e9lectrolyte de la batterie, d\u00e9truisant la densit\u00e9 et l'homog\u00e9n\u00e9it\u00e9 de la membrane SEI, ce qui entra\u00eene une augmentation progressive de la r\u00e9sistance interne de la batterie, et la capacit\u00e9 de d\u00e9charge de la batterie diminue continuellement.<\/p><h3 id=\"shortened-cycle-life\">Dur\u00e9e de vie r\u00e9duite<\/h3><p>Une teneur en eau excessive d\u00e9truit le film SEI de la batterie, la r\u00e9sistance interne augmente progressivement, la capacit\u00e9 de d\u00e9charge de la batterie devient de plus en plus faible, et le temps d'utilisation de la batterie devient de plus en plus court chaque fois que la batterie est compl\u00e8tement charg\u00e9e, le nombre de fois que la batterie peut \u00eatre utilis\u00e9e normalement (cycle) diminuera naturellement, et le temps d'utilisation (dur\u00e9e de vie) de la batterie sera raccourci.<\/p><p><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ter size-full wp-image-31372\" src=\"https:\/\/batteryswapstation.com\/wp-content\/uploads\/2024\/01\/Sources-of-water-in-the-production-of-lithium-batteries.webp\" alt=\"ources d&#039;eau dans la production de batteries au lithium\" width=\"1200\" height=\"600\" \/><\/p><h2 id=\"sources-of-water-in-the-production-of-lithium-batteries\">Sources d'eau dans la production de piles au lithium<\/h2><p>Dans le processus de fabrication des piles au lithium, la source d'humidit\u00e9 peut \u00eatre divis\u00e9e en plusieurs aspects :<\/p><p><strong>1. Humidit\u00e9 apport\u00e9e par les mati\u00e8res premi\u00e8res<\/strong><\/p><ul><li><strong>Mat\u00e9riaux positifs et n\u00e9gatifs :<\/strong> les substances actives positives et n\u00e9gatives sont des particules de l'ordre du micron et du nanom\u00e8tre, qui absorbent tr\u00e8s facilement l'eau dans l'air ; en particulier, les substances actives ternaires ou binaires sont des particules de l'ordre du micron et du nanom\u00e8tre. <span style=\"text-decoration: underline;color: #333399\"><a style=\"color: #333399;text-decoration: underline\" href=\"https:\/\/batteryswapstation.com\/fr\/cathode-materials\/\" target=\"_blank\" rel=\"noopener\">mat\u00e9riaux de cathode<\/a><\/span> \u00e0 forte teneur en Ni (nickel) ont une grande surface sp\u00e9cifique, et la surface du mat\u00e9riau est tr\u00e8s facile \u00e0 absorber l'eau et \u00e0 r\u00e9agir. Si l'environnement de stockage de la pi\u00e8ce de poteau rev\u00eatue est tr\u00e8s humide, le rev\u00eatement de surface de la pi\u00e8ce de poteau absorbera rapidement l'humidit\u00e9 de l'air.<\/li><li><strong>\u00c9lectrolyte :<\/strong> le composant solvant dans le <span style=\"text-decoration: underline;color: #333399\"><a style=\"color: #333399;text-decoration: underline\" href=\"https:\/\/batteryswapstation.com\/fr\/lithium-ion-battery-electrolyte\/\" target=\"_blank\" rel=\"noopener\">\u00e9lectrolyte pour batterie lithium-ion<\/a><\/span> r\u00e9agira avec les mol\u00e9cules d'eau ; le sel de lithium solut\u00e9 dans l'\u00e9lectrolyte est \u00e9galement susceptible d'absorber de l'eau et de r\u00e9agir chimiquement ; il y aura donc une certaine quantit\u00e9 d'eau \u00e0 l'int\u00e9rieur de l'\u00e9lectrolyte ; si l'\u00e9lectrolyte est stock\u00e9 pendant une longue p\u00e9riode ou \u00e0 une temp\u00e9rature trop \u00e9lev\u00e9e dans l'environnement de stockage, la teneur en eau \u00e0 l'int\u00e9rieur de l'\u00e9lectrolyte augmentera \u00e9galement.<\/li><li><strong>S\u00e9parateur :<\/strong> Le s\u00e9parateur est un film plastique poreux (PP\/PE) qui est \u00e9galement tr\u00e8s absorbant.<\/li><\/ul><p><strong>2. l'eau ajout\u00e9e dans la fabrication de la feuille d'\u00e9lectrode<\/strong><\/p><p>De l'eau sera ajout\u00e9e \u00e0 la pulpe de l'\u00e9lectrode n\u00e9gative et m\u00e9lang\u00e9e aux mati\u00e8res premi\u00e8res, puis enduite, de sorte que la feuille de l'\u00e9lectrode n\u00e9gative elle-m\u00eame contient de l'eau. Au cours du processus d'enrobage ult\u00e9rieur, malgr\u00e9 le chauffage et le s\u00e9chage, une grande partie de l'eau reste adsorb\u00e9e dans l'enrobage de la pi\u00e8ce polaire.<\/p><p><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ter size-full wp-image-31373\" src=\"https:\/\/batteryswapstation.com\/wp-content\/uploads\/2024\/01\/Workshop-environment-moisture.webp\" alt=\"Atelier-environnement-humidit\u00e9\" width=\"1200\" height=\"600\" \/><\/p><p><strong>3. Humidit\u00e9 de l'environnement de l'atelier<\/strong><\/p><ul><li><strong>Humidit\u00e9 contenue dans l'air de l'atelier :<\/strong> L'humidit\u00e9 de l'air est g\u00e9n\u00e9ralement mesur\u00e9e en humidit\u00e9 relative. Selon les saisons et les conditions m\u00e9t\u00e9orologiques, l'humidit\u00e9 relative varie consid\u00e9rablement ; au printemps et en \u00e9t\u00e9, l'humidit\u00e9 de l'air est relativement \u00e9lev\u00e9e (plus de 60%), en automne et en hiver, l'air est plus sec et l'humidit\u00e9 est plus faible (moins de 40%) ; les jours de pluie, l'humidit\u00e9 de l'air est plus \u00e9lev\u00e9e, les jours ensoleill\u00e9s, elle est plus faible. Ainsi, en fonction de l'humidit\u00e9 de l'air, la teneur en eau de l'air est diff\u00e9rente.<\/li><li>Eau produite par le corps humain (sueur humaine, souffle expir\u00e9, eau de lavage des mains)<\/li><li>Eau apport\u00e9e par divers mat\u00e9riaux auxiliaires et papiers (carton, chiffons, relev\u00e9s)<\/li><\/ul><h2 id=\"how-to-control-the-water-in-llithium-batteries\">Comment contr\u00f4ler l'eau dans les piles au lithium ?<\/h2><p><strong>1. Contr\u00f4le des mati\u00e8res premi\u00e8res<\/strong><\/p><p>Dans le processus de production des piles au lithium, le contr\u00f4le des mati\u00e8res premi\u00e8res est tr\u00e8s important. Parmi celles-ci, les mati\u00e8res premi\u00e8res telles que l'\u00e9lectrolyte, le s\u00e9parateur, les \u00e9lectrodes positives et n\u00e9gatives peuvent contenir de l'eau. Par cons\u00e9quent, au cours du processus d'approvisionnement, ces mati\u00e8res premi\u00e8res doivent faire l'objet d'un contr\u00f4le de qualit\u00e9 rigoureux afin de s'assurer que leur teneur en eau est conforme \u00e0 la norme.<\/p><p>Entre-temps, au cours du processus de stockage et d'utilisation, des mesures appropri\u00e9es doivent \u00eatre prises, telles que le stockage au sec et l'\u00e9vitement de la lumi\u00e8re directe du soleil, afin de pr\u00e9venir l'impact de l'eau sur les mati\u00e8res premi\u00e8res.<\/p><p><strong>2. Contr\u00f4le du processus de production<\/strong><\/p><p>Dans le lithium <span style=\"text-decoration: underline;color: #333399\"><a style=\"color: #333399;text-decoration: underline\" href=\"https:\/\/batteryswapstation.com\/fr\/battery-production\/\" target=\"_blank\" rel=\"noopener\">production de batteries<\/a><\/span> une s\u00e9rie de mesures doivent \u00eatre prises pour contr\u00f4ler l'eau. Par exemple, dans le processus de pr\u00e9paration des \u00e9lectrodes, il est n\u00e9cessaire de s'assurer que le processus de m\u00e9lange et d'enrobage des mat\u00e9riaux d'\u00e9lectrode n'introduit pas trop d'eau.<\/p><p>Parall\u00e8lement, dans le processus d'assemblage de la batterie, il est n\u00e9cessaire de s\u00e9lectionner le diaphragme et l'\u00e9lectrolyte appropri\u00e9s, et de s'assurer que l'environnement d'assemblage pr\u00e9sente une faible humidit\u00e9 relative. En outre, dans le processus de formation de la batterie, la temp\u00e9rature et le temps de formation doivent \u00eatre contr\u00f4l\u00e9s pour \u00e9viter l'influence de l'eau sur les performances de la batterie.<\/p><p><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ter size-full wp-image-31374\" src=\"https:\/\/batteryswapstation.com\/wp-content\/uploads\/2024\/01\/How-to-control-the-water-in-llithium-batteries.webp\" alt=\"Comment contr\u00f4ler l&#039;eau dans les piles au lithium ?\" width=\"1200\" height=\"600\" \/><\/p><p><strong>3. S\u00e9lection et contr\u00f4le des \u00e9quipements<\/strong><\/p><p>Dans le processus de production des piles au lithium, la s\u00e9lection et le contr\u00f4le des \u00e9quipements sont \u00e9galement tr\u00e8s importants. Afin de contr\u00f4ler efficacement la teneur en eau, il est n\u00e9cessaire de choisir l'\u00e9quipement et la technologie de s\u00e9chage appropri\u00e9s, tels que le s\u00e9chage sous vide, le s\u00e9chage \u00e0 l'air chaud, etc.<\/p><p>Parall\u00e8lement, l'inspection et l'entretien r\u00e9guliers de l'\u00e9quipement de production sont \u00e9galement n\u00e9cessaires au cours du processus de production afin de garantir son fonctionnement normal et d'\u00e9viter les fuites d'eau et d'autres probl\u00e8mes.<\/p><p><strong>4. Essais et analyses<\/strong><\/p><p>Afin de s'assurer que la qualit\u00e9 et les performances des piles au lithium r\u00e9pondent aux exigences, la pile doit \u00eatre test\u00e9e et analys\u00e9e. La d\u00e9tection de l'eau est un \u00e9l\u00e9ment tr\u00e8s important. Les m\u00e9thodes de d\u00e9tection de l'eau couramment utilis\u00e9es sont la chromatographie en phase gazeuse, la spectrom\u00e9trie de masse, la m\u00e9thode Karl Fischer, etc.<\/p><p>Ces m\u00e9thodes de d\u00e9tection permettent de d\u00e9tecter efficacement la teneur en eau de la batterie et de la contr\u00f4ler et de la traiter en cons\u00e9quence.
